Job position Lead/Développeur Python - Middle Office
Share this job
Sur le périmètre Allocation / Middle-Office critique opérationnel très rapidement, capable d’absorber du run + des Major Projects du client tout en portant la trajectoire Python 1st et la délégation au support.
Profil
15+ ans d’expérience sur des systèmes critiques en environnement de marché.
Finance indispensable, avec une expérience significative sur des sujets Middle-Office / post-trade (allocation, lifecycle trade, positions, process de production).
Capacité confirmée à être opérationnel rapidement sur un SI complexe et sur des sujets à fort enjeu (Major Projects du client dont Unified Exec).
Très bon niveau technique : conception pragmatique, qualité, tests, performance, production readiness.
Attendus spécifiques:
Être opérationnel rapidement sur le métier Middle-Office
Comprendre et maîtriser rapidement les flux post-trade (trade → allocation → positions → impacts coûts/risques).
Être capable de challenger des besoins Ops / Trading-Support / Portfolio sur les sujets allocation, exceptions, et process de production.
Assurer la continuité du périmètre Allocation
Prendre le rôle de référent de l'équipe, tout en organisant le partage de connaissance (docs, pairing, transfert vers l’équipe).
Structurer le run (runbooks, procédures, ownership clair) pour que l’équipe puisse tenir le périmètre même en cas d’absence.
Leader de production : incidents, RCA, fiabilisation
Piloter les incidents majeurs de bout en bout (diagnostic, coordination inter-équipes, communication, mitigation, retour à la normale).
Produire des root cause analyses actionnables et s’assurer que les actions correctives sont effectivement livrées (pas seulement documentées).
Améliorer monitoring/alerting selon un principe clair : une alerte = utile, actionnable, avec un owner.
Accélérer la réduction de dette technique et porter “Python 1st”
Être moteur sur la sortie progressive de la logique métier Oracle/PL/SQL (pas de nouvelles procédures ; trajectoire de migration).
Livrer 1–2 refactors structurants sur le périmètre allocation/production, avec un vrai gain de maintenabilité et de robustesse (tests, design, observabilité).
Délégation au support : posture de partenaire (Front-Support/Ops)
Construire un plan de délégation concret (périmètre, garde-fous, checks, formation) et le faire avancer.
Transformer la logique “IT garde la main” en une logique “clients autonomes + contrôles + monitoring” afin de libérer de la capacité de dev.
Être un enabler sur les Major Projects du client (Unified Exec)
Identifier rapidement les dépendances, risques, et besoins de l’équipe Portfolio Middleoffice sur Unified Exec (MANAX / Crossing / règles d’exécution...).
Être capable de proposer des options réalistes, d’aligner les parties prenantes et de sécuriser des mises en production.
Livrables attendus :
Le/la prestataire devra, en coordination avec le manager de l’équipe Portfolio Middleoffice, contribuer à la réalisation d’un sous-ensemble significatif des livrables suivants :
1. Continuité et fiabilisation du périmètre Allocation / Unified Exec
Note de synthèse à jour sur la chaîne d’allocation ITMO (périmètre, règles, cas particuliers, dépendances clés).
Contribution à au moins une mise en production structurante (par ex. évolution Unified Exec / Managed Accounts / Secure Managed Accounts) avec : plan de tests, stratégie de rollback, contrôles post-MEP documentés.
2. Dette technique & trajectoire Python 1st
Cartographie ciblée de la dette technique sur le périmètre confié (allocation / batch / écrans) et proposition d’un backlog priorisé de remédiations.
Réalisation de 1 à 2 refontes ou refactors structurants (par ex. migration d’un module PL/SQL vers Python, simplification d’un composant critique) améliorant la maintenabilité et la robustesse.
3. Support, délégation et documentation opérationnelle
Rédaction de notebooks pour les incidents fréquents sur la chaîne d’allocation, utilisables par Front-Support / Ops (procédure, critères d’escalade).
Contribution à un plan de délégation vers Front-Support/Ops (définition du périmètre transféré, prérequis, étapes), avec au moins un premier lot effectivement transféré.
4. Alertes & monitoring
Revue des alertes existantes sur le périmètre (bruit vs utile) et réduction mesurable du nombre d’alertes non actionnables.
Amélioration ou mise en place d’une vue de monitoring (dashboard ou équivalent) pour suivre l’état de la chaîne d’allocation et les alertes critiques.
5. Modernisation écrans / interfaces (si inclus dans la mission)
Participation à la définition d’un plan de modernisation des écrans concernés (priorités, dépendances, attentes des utilisateurs).
Contribution à la refonte ou à la création de 1 à 2 écrans clés, limitant les accès directs à Oracle et améliorant l’autonomie des équipes clientes.
6. GenAI (optionnel mais fortement souhaité)
Utilisation de l’IA générative sur le périmètre (refactor de code, génération de tests, analyse de logs), avec au moins 1–2 cas d’usage concrets documentés montrant le gain (temps, qualité).
Candidate profile
Profil
15+ ans d’expérience sur des systèmes critiques en environnement de marché.
Expertise Python - Fast API / Pandas
Expérience de Lead
Finance indispensable, avec une expérience significative sur des sujets Middle-Office / post-trade (allocation, lifecycle trade, positions, process de production).
Capacité confirmée à être opérationnel rapidement sur un SI complexe et sur des sujets à fort enjeu (Major Projects du client dont Unified Exec).
Très bon niveau technique : conception pragmatique, qualité, tests, performance, production readiness.
Working environment
Profil
15+ ans d’expérience sur des systèmes critiques en environnement de marché.
Expertise Python - Fast API / Pandas
Expérience de Lead
Finance indispensable, avec une expérience significative sur des sujets Middle-Office / post-trade (allocation, lifecycle trade, positions, process de production).
Capacité confirmée à être opérationnel rapidement sur un SI complexe et sur des sujets à fort enjeu (Major Projects du client dont Unified Exec).
Très bon niveau technique : conception pragmatique, qualité, tests, performance, production readiness.
Apply to this job!
Find your next career move from +700 jobs!
-
Manage your visibility
Salary, remote work... Define all the criteria that are important to you.
-
Get discovered
Recruiters come directly to look for their future hires in our CV library.
-
Join a community
Connect with like-minded tech and IT professionals on a daily basis through our forum.
Lead/Développeur Python - Middle Office
Cherry Pick
